Crosswalk Accident Claims in California: Who Is Responsible?
Daniel Petrov | August 19, 2026 | California Law, Car Accident, Personal Injury
In most crosswalk accident claims in California, the driver is legally responsible under California Vehicle Code Section 21950, which requires all drivers to yield to pedestrians in marked and unmarked crosswalks. How Long Do Personal Injury Lawsuits Take in California?
Daniel Petrov | June 17, 2026 | Personal Injury
Most personal injury cases in California take between six months and two years to resolve, and cases that go to trial can take three years or longer.
